Barbara Benkó

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Benkó in 2012

Barbara Benkó (born 21 January 1990) is a Hungarian former cross-country mountain biker.[1][2] Born in Budapest, Benko competed in the Women's cross-country at the 2012 Summer Olympics, held at Hadleigh Farm, finishing in 27th place.[2]
